2. 分析导致String index out of range: 4这个具体错误的原因 假设有一个字符串String str = "abc";,它的长度是3(索引范围是0到2)。如果尝试访问str.charAt(4)或者进行类似的操作(如str.substring(2, 5)),就会因为索引4超出了字符串的有效范围(0到2)而抛出StringIndexOutOfBoundsException,并显示错误信息S...
复制代码调试和错误处理:如果以上方法仍然无法解决问题,您可以使用调试工具来跟踪代码并查找导致索引超出范围错误的位置。另外,可以使用try-catch块来捕获并处理"String index out of range"异常,以提供更好的错误处理和用户友好的错误消息。希望这些方法可以帮助您解决"String index out of range"问题!0 赞 0 踩最新...
这个程序一直给我一个错误: Exception in thread "main“java.lang.StringIndexOutOfBoundsException: Str...
Received acquired passwordjava.lang.StringIndexOutOfBoundsException: String index out of range: 4 at java.lang.String.substring(***.java:1935) at com.goldhuman.account.storage.StringPassword(***.java:399) at com.goldhuman.account.storage.acquireIdPasswd(***.java:425) at protocol.MatrixPasswd....
java.lang.StringIndexOutOfBoundsException: String index out of range: 4 Go to solution Former Member on 2007 Jun 07 0 Kudos 968 SAP Managed Tags: SAP Enterprise Portal Hello, I'm trying to configure webdynpros for ESS in SAP EP 7. I've a problem in Personal Information:...
在上面的示例中,字符串text的长度是13,而我们试图访问的索引范围是0到15,超出了字符串的实际长度。这将导致java.lang.StringIndexOutOfBoundsException异常。 二、可能出错的原因 导致java.lang.StringIndexOutOfBoundsException的原因主要包括以下几种: 索引超出范围:尝试访问的索引超出了字符串的长度。例如,字符串长度...
Java replace replaceAll 报错 String index out of range: 1以及斜杠反斜杠在repalce replaceAll中遇到的一些问题总结反斜杠同时也是转义符在正则表达式里面 工具/原料 电脑 MyEclipse 方法/步骤 1 反斜杠:\\ 斜杠:/public static void main(String[] args) {String fileUrl="/pdf/test.pdf";fileUrl= ...
安装了 com.cb.eclipse.folding折叠插件, 在代码比较特殊或代码比较多的情况下,java文件带不开,会报 String index out of range:xx 的错误,只能用文本打开,解决方法是把eclipse\plugins\com.cb.eclipse.folding_1.0.6.jar(我用的这个版本)删除(最好删了,也可以不删),把floding设置成默认的,重启eclipse,就可以...
突然出现java.lang.StringIndexOutOfBoundsException: String index out of range: -1 的错误是设置错误造成的,解决方法为:1、右击有错误提示的文件夹,如下。2、我们点击”配置构建路径“,如下。3、我们再点击”添加库“,如下。4、我们选中上图中标出的选项,再点击下一步。5、我们再点击”完成...
java.lang.StringIndexOutOfBoundsException是一个继承自IndexOutOfBoundsException的运行时异常。它表示在字符串操作中发生了索引越界的错误。 在Java中,字符串的索引是从0开始的,也就是说,第一个字符的索引为0,第二个字符的索引为1,以此类推。当我们对字符串进行操作时,如果我们使用的索引超出了字符串的边界,就会...